Chapter 6 - Section 6.7 - Shapes and Polarity of Molecules - Questions and Problems - Page 196: 6.59a

Answer

Tetrahedral shape

Work Step by Step

A molecule with a central atom that has four electron groups and four bonded atoms should have tetrahedral shape.
